NoteMeeting and Scriptli are both AI meeting assistants for recording, transcription, and summaries, compared here on pricing, features, and workflow fit. NoteMeeting: AI meeting notetaker and live voice translator delivered as a Chrome extension and desktop app, supporting Google Meet, Zoom, and Microsoft Teams. Scriptli: Swiss AI transcription tool specialising in Swiss German audio, with output formats including meeting notes, summaries and verbatim transcripts. They overlap on ai-meeting-assistants, so the right pick depends on team size, budget, and which meeting workflows you automate.
For ai-meeting-assistants workflows, shortlist NoteMeeting when cross-language meetings that need live translation alongside notes matters most, and Scriptli when transcribing recorded swiss german meetings or interviews into german text matters most. Both record across Zoom, Google Meet, and Microsoft Teams; trial each on real meetings before committing.

Pros & cons
NoteMeeting
+ Combines transcription, summarization, and live translation in one tool
+ Available both as a browser extension and native desktop apps
- Translation features are oriented around specific language pairs rather than all languages equally
Scriptli
+ Specialised handling of hard-to-transcribe Swiss German dialects
+ Swiss-hosted with a clear data-sovereignty positioning
- Primarily file/upload based rather than a live meeting-bot that joins calls
